This Android M boot animation is compressed into a zip file to make the process little easier for you. You can easily flash this app just by using custom recovery such as TWRP. Good thing is you can flash this zip file without rooting your device.

Download the require file

Android M Boot Animation: bootanimation-flashable.zip

Steps to Flash Android M Boot Animation on Lollipop & KitKat

1. First of all download this file and transfer it to your device storage.

2. After that disconnect and turn off your device.

3. Now you need to reboot your device into recovery mode. Method to get your device into recovery mode varies by device, you can use power and volume keys combination.

4. Once you’re in recovery mode, you need to wipe cache and dalvik cache.

5. After that using your volume up and download key go to “Install” or “Install zip file”.

6. Now navigate to the folder where you have place the zip file of the boot animation and select it by pressing the power button.

7. You will notice that flashing process is started

After following above steps you need to wait for few second to complete the flashing process. Once its done reboor your device. You can enjoy the new Android M boot animation on your device.
